Nursing is an incredibly important profession and the job market for nurses in Paragould, Arkansas is booming! With an aging population, the need for nurses is increasing and the opportunities for nurses in the area are abundant. Paragould is a small city located in Northeast Arkansas, about an hour and a half from Little Rock. The town is home to a number of hospitals, nursing homes, and clinics, making it an ideal place for nurses to find employment. There are also a number of educational opportunities in the area, including nursing schools and universities offering degrees in nursing. One of the most attractive aspects of nursing jobs in Paragould is the competitive salaries. Nurses in the area can expect to make a good living, with salaries ranging from $30,000 to $90,000 per year. The cost of living in Paragould is relatively low, making it an affordable place to live and work. The job market for nurses in Paragould is varied and diverse. There are jobs available in hospitals, nursing homes, clinics, and other healthcare facilities. Nurses can also find work in schools, government offices, and other organizations. In addition, nurses can specialize in a variety of areas, including pediatrics, geriatrics, mental health, and emergency care. Nurses in Paragould also have the opportunity to advance their careers through continuing education and professional development. Continuing education opportunities are available through local universities and colleges, as well as through online programs. Professional development opportunities include workshops, conferences, and certifications that can help nurses stay up-to-date on the latest trends in the nursing field. As summer approaches, students across the city of Sarnia are gearing up for the job hunt. With the end of the school year comes the opportunity to gain valuable work experience, earn some extra income, and develop new skills that can be applied to future careers. In this article, we’ll take a closer look at some of the best summer job opportunities available to students in Sarnia for the summer of 2013. Retail Jobs One of the most popular summer job options for students is working in retail. Sarnia boasts a variety of shopping destinations, from the Lambton Mall to the downtown boutiques, creating ample opportunities for students of all skill levels. Whether you’re interested in fashion, electronics, or groceries, there are a wide range of retail jobs available in Sarnia. Working in retail can be an excellent way to develop customer service skills, learn how to manage inventory, and gain experience working with a team. Retail jobs often pay minimum wage, but many offer flexible scheduling, making it easy to balance work with other summer activities. Hospitality Jobs Sarnia is a popular tourist destination, particularly during the summer months when visitors flock to the city’s beaches, parks, and marinas. As a result, there are numerous hospitality jobs available to students looking to work in the service industry. Whether you’re interested in working in a restaurant, hotel, or tourist attraction, there are plenty of opportunities to gain experience in the hospitality sector. Working in hospitality can be a great way to develop teamwork and communication skills, learn how to manage customer expectations, and work in a fast-paced environment. Jobs in hospitality often offer flexible scheduling, tips, and the opportunity to meet new people from around the world. Outdoor Jobs Sarnia is home to some of the most beautiful parks and beaches in Ontario, making it an ideal destination for outdoor enthusiasts. As a result, there are many summer job opportunities available for students who enjoy working outside. Whether you’re interested in working as a lifeguard, park ranger, or tour guide, there are plenty of outdoor jobs available in Sarnia. Working outdoors can be an excellent way to develop leadership and communication skills, learn about the local environment, and build physical endurance. Outdoor jobs often offer flexible scheduling, access to beautiful natural spaces, and the opportunity to work with a diverse group of people. Office Jobs While many summer jobs involve working in customer service or hospitality, there are also plenty of office-based opportunities available for students in Sarnia. Whether you’re interested in working in administration, data entry, or marketing, there are a wide range of office jobs available to students. Working in an office can be an excellent way to develop computer skills, learn how to manage projects, and gain experience working in a professional environment. Office jobs often offer flexible scheduling, the opportunity to work on interesting projects, and the chance to build professional relationships with coworkers. Internships and Co-Ops For students looking to gain experience in a specific industry, internships and co-ops can be an excellent option. Many businesses in Sarnia offer summer internships and co-op opportunities to students, providing them with the chance to gain real-world experience in their chosen field. Internships and co-ops can be an excellent way to build skills, gain industry-specific knowledge, and make connections with professionals in your field. While many internships and co-ops are unpaid, they can provide valuable experience that can help you stand out in the job market after graduation. Conclusion Overall, there are a wide range of summer job opportunities available to students in Sarnia. Whether you’re interested in retail, hospitality, outdoor work, or office jobs, there are plenty of options to choose from. No matter which job you choose, summer employment can provide valuable experience, help you develop new skills, and earn some extra income to help you achieve your goals.

The Receptionist Job in Birmingham, UK: Opportunities and Challenges Birmingham, the second-largest city in the United Kingdom, is a bustling hub of commerce and industry. As such, it offers a wide range of job opportunities for people of various skills and backgrounds. One of the most common jobs in Birmingham is that of a receptionist. Receptionist jobs in Birmingham are available in various sectors, including healthcare, hospitality, finance, and legal services. In this article, we will discuss the role of a receptionist in Birmingham, the skills required, the salary, and the challenges. The Role of a Receptionist in Birmingham A receptionist is an essential part of any organization. They are the first point of contact for visitors, clients, and customers. They greet people, answer calls, and direct them to the appropriate person or department. The role of a receptionist in Birmingham is no different from that of a receptionist in any other city. However, the specific duties may vary depending on the sector and the organization. For example, a receptionist in a healthcare facility in Birmingham may be responsible for scheduling appointments, handling medical records, and answering patient queries. On the other hand, a receptionist in a law firm may need to handle legal documents, manage calendars, and provide administrative support to lawyers. Skills Required for a Receptionist Job in Birmingham To be successful as a receptionist in Birmingham, you need to possess several skills that are essential to the job. Some of the critical skills required are: 1. Communication: A receptionist needs to have excellent communication skills, both verbal and written. They should be able to convey information clearly and concisely and understand the needs of the people they are interacting with. 2. Customer Service: A receptionist needs to have a friendly and welcoming demeanor. They should be able to make visitors feel comfortable and at ease. 3. Multitasking: A receptionist needs to be able to handle multiple tasks simultaneously. They should be able to prioritize tasks and manage their time efficiently. 4. Organizational Skills: A receptionist needs to be organized and detail-oriented. They should be able to keep track of appointments, schedules, and documents. 5. Computer Skills: A receptionist needs to be proficient in using computers and software such as Microsoft Office, email, and electronic scheduling systems. Salary for a Receptionist Job in Birmingham The salary for a receptionist job in Birmingham varies depending on the sector, the organization, and the level of experience. According to Payscale, the average salary for a receptionist in Birmingham is £17,000 per year. However, the salary can range from £14,000 to £21,000 per year. Challenges of a Receptionist Job in Birmingham While a receptionist job in Birmingham can be rewarding, it also comes with its challenges. Some of the common challenges faced by receptionists in Birmingham are: 1. Dealing with Difficult People: Receptionists often have to deal with difficult people, including angry customers, impatient visitors, and demanding clients. They need to remain calm and composed in such situations and handle them with tact and diplomacy. 2. Multitasking: As mentioned earlier, receptionists need to multitask and handle multiple tasks simultaneously. This can be challenging, especially during peak hours when there is a high volume of calls and visitors. 3. Managing Stress: Receptionists have to deal with a lot of stress, especially when there are tight deadlines or challenging situations. They need to develop coping mechanisms and manage stress effectively to avoid burnout. Conclusion In conclusion, a receptionist job in Birmingham offers a range of opportunities and challenges. It is a vital role that requires excellent communication, customer service, multitasking, organizational, and computer skills. While the salary may not be high, the job can be rewarding in terms of job satisfaction and career growth. If you are looking for a career as a receptionist in Birmingham, make sure you possess the necessary skills, and are prepared to face the challenges that come with the job.
